Why Smart Businesses Order Year-End Stock Early
There is a quiet power in being early, and it goes far beyond pricing. Early print planning 2026 allows businesses to approach the year-end period with clarity and calm. It also means you can avoid the production queues that every print house, courier company, and agency experiences as the holidays approach.
Turnaround times are significantly quicker when you plan. Printers are able to allocate resources more efficiently, which means your banners, posters, flyers, and signage move smoothly through production. There is no need for rush fees or emergency edits.
Design quality also improves when there is no countdown timer ticking in the background. You can experiment with festive concepts, fine-tune your typography, work with premium substrates, or try creative finishes such as matte laminations or soft-touch coatings. The freedom to iterate often leads to far stronger campaign assets.
Material availability is another factor. Speciality stocks, finishes, inks, and decorative touches are in high demand toward the end of the year. When you order early, you avoid the possibility of shortages and ensure your packaging, branded packaging, stickers, or holiday cards are printed with the materials you originally intended.
And finally, there is peace of mind. Once your prints are done, they are done. They can sit safely in your storeroom, office, or fulfilment centre while you focus on managing your team, your customers, and your peak-season operations.

Why Waiting For Specials Costs More In The Long Run
It is easy to assume that waiting for Black Friday will save money, but in practice, it often creates hidden expenses. Production queues always become longer in November, which means your job competes with hundreds of others. This increases the risk of tight deadlines, errors, and last-minute change requests that could have been avoided.
Courier delays are also common. National freight networks experience strain during the festive shipping peak, and coastal or rural deliveries are often affected first. Waiting for deals can mean you lose valuable days simply because parcels cannot move quickly enough through the system.
Stock shortages happen, too, especially for speciality papers or decorative finishes. If your campaign relies on a particular texture, foil, or colour, waiting too long puts that creative vision at risk.
Time pressure is another hidden cost. When you leave printing too late, design teams are rushed, approvals are hasty, and campaigns do not always reflect the level of care or polish you intended. Missed marketing opportunities are arguably the biggest loss of all.
